Except it is literally called the 37mm gun M3. This is the cover for the technical manual for the gun. Also, the M3 was developed after studying two German Pak 36 37mm AT guns procured from Rheinmetall.

I mean, our entire policing system is different anyway. Not every city, town, county and parish does its own police, but it's all done on the state level. Each of the 16 states has its own state police, that do all the policing (patrol and investigation).
